Its sequel, 1992's Retribution, was just as strong, featuring two new members added from Solstice -- guitarist Rob Barrett (who replaced Juskiewicz) and drummer Alex Marquez. Barrett and Marquez were replaced by John Rubin (who had been in a very early lineup of the band) and "Crazy" Larry Hawke for 1993's Stillborn, which disappointed many of the group's faithful and signaled an acrimonious end to their relationship with Roadrunner.
Those label difficulties nearly broke the band apart, but they eventually resurfaced on Pavement Music with a more progressive, technical approach and an even more revamped lineup on 1995's Eternal. Hoffmann was gone, with the vocals now handled by bassist Blachowicz, while guitarists Fasciana and Rubin were joined by ex-Suffocation drummer Dave Culross. The remixes/outtakes/demos collection Joe Black appeared in 1996, followed the next year by In Cold Blood, which featured guitarist John Paul Soars taking Rubin's place, and drummer Derik Roddy replacing Culross.
For 1998's The Fine Art of Murder, Fasciana (now doubling on keyboards) brought vocalist Hoffmann, guitarist Barret, and drummer Culross back to the fold, along with new bassist Gordon Simms. The Pavement label retrospective, Manifestation, appeared in 2000, followed towards the end of the year by the all-new Envenomed. The sequel to Envenomed came out two years later, followed a few months later by drummer Justin DiPinto's last album with the group, The Will to Kill.

The lyrics of Malevolent Creation's song "Eternal" are dark and foreboding. The song is essentially about death and the bleakness of an afterlife. The first verse describes a lifeless corpse and the end of someone's existence. The second verse speaks more to a total loss of control and consciousness, almost as if the body has already perished and the mind is trapped in limbo. The chorus declares that there is no escape from the void beyond and no hope for a peaceful rest. The final verses describe a sense of being trapped in a dark, inescapable place where there is no hope of light or joy.
The overall theme of the song can be seen as a reflection on the inevitability of death and the despair that comes with thinking about the unknowns of what happens after we die. The lyrics seem to be written from the point of view of someone who is facing an imminent death or is experiencing an afterlife that is far different from what they expected.
